Opening Round Table \u2014 Reading the Global Governance Agenda from Paris<\/h3>\n<p><strong>Sessions<\/strong>: Opening plenary &quot;La Gouvernance de l&#39;Internet : discussions en cours au niveau mondial&quot; (9:00\u201310:15)<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Axelle Lemaire, Secretary of State for Digital Affairs, opened the forum; with the IANA transition and WSIS+10 review under way in 2015, the opening round table mapped the state of global negotiations [1][3]<\/li>\n<li>Panellists combined government, parliament and the technical community: Nicolas Chagny (ISOC France president), David Martinon (Foreign Ministry special representative for information-society negotiations), Senator Catherine Morin-Desailly and Mathieu Weill (Afnic CEO) [1][3]<\/li>\n<li>The closing plenary was steered by Camille Vaziaga (Renaissance Num\u00e9rique) and S\u00e9bastien Bachollet (honorary president of ISOC France, former ICANN Board member) [1][3]<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>2. Platform Power and New Economies \u2014 From Network Effects to Sharing<\/h3>\n<p><strong>Sessions<\/strong>: Workshops &quot;Effets de r\u00e9seau et situations de dominance&quot;, &quot;Responsabilit\u00e9 des plateformes&quot;, &quot;Economie collaborative et partage&quot;<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>The morning &quot;network effects and dominance&quot; and afternoon &quot;platform accountability&quot; workshops anticipated the European debate on how to confront big-platform market power [1][3]<\/li>\n<li>The sharing-economy workshop, moderated by Startingdot president Godefroy Jordan, asked &quot;new ways of working in the 21st century?&quot; as collaborative platforms boomed [1][3]<\/li>\n<li>A parallel workshop, &quot;Big Data et Objets Connect\u00e9s&quot;, tackled connected devices and data handling [1][3]<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>3. Surveillance and Post-Mortem Digital Rights \u2014 Under the Shadow of the Intelligence Bill<\/h3>\n<p><strong>Sessions<\/strong>: Workshops &quot;Surveillance&quot; and &quot;Droit num\u00e9rique des morts&quot;<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>The surveillance workshop examined algorithmic security \u2014 as France&#39;s intelligence bill (loi renseignement), expanding surveillance powers, entered its final parliamentary stretch (adopted 24 June 2015) [1][3]<\/li>\n<li>The &quot;digital rights of the deceased&quot; workshop, moderated by ISOC France vice-president Matthieu Camus, raised the then-novel question of what happens to social-media profiles and personal data after death [1][3]<\/li>\n<li>Both threads fed the debate that surfaced in France&#39;s 2016 Digital Republic Act, which included provisions on post-mortem data [1][3]<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>4. Francophone Governance and a Solidarity Internet \u2014 The Inclusion Homework<\/h3>\n<p><strong>Sessions<\/strong>: Workshops &quot;La gouvernance en fran\u00e7ais&quot; and &quot;Internet solidaire&quot;<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>The &quot;governance in French&quot; workshop, moderated by ISOC France vice-president Yves Miezan-Ezo, asked how francophone perspectives could weigh in a global debate dominated by English [1][3]<\/li>\n<li>&quot;Internet solidaire&quot;, moderated by Afnic deputy CEO Pierre Bonis, asked how digital technology can narrow the social divide, making inclusion a headline theme [1][3]<\/li>\n<li>A case of a national IGF localising the global forum&#39;s core themes of access gaps and linguistic diversity [1][3]<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Three-Minute Short Talk \u2014 Your Questions Answered<\/h2>\n<p><strong>Q. What was the highlight of this edition?<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>A. Digital-affairs minister Axelle Lemaire opening the forum, with government, parliament and the technical community sharing one round table on the global governance negotiations of 2015.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Q. Any unusual topics?<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>A. &quot;Digital rights of the deceased&quot; \u2014 what happens to your accounts and data after death. Cutting-edge for 2015, and France&#39;s Digital Republic Act picked up the theme the following year.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Q. Why does it matter?<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>A. Platform power, surveillance versus privacy, and digital legacies all became mainstream policy questions worldwide. FGI France 2015 shows a national IGF debating them in real time, alongside a live legislative fight over surveillance.<\/p>\n<h2>What Is France IGF?
